[Detailed Description of the Invention] (Industrial Application Field) The present invention relates to a sandbag making machine that can mechanically and continuously manufacture sandbags, which are used, for example, as a means of stopping water during flooding.

(Prior Art) When a river is abnormally flooded due to a typhoon or the like, restoration work is often carried out using sandbags as an emergency water stoppage measure.

However, in the past, the construction of sandbags was
Because it relied solely on human labor, it was extremely difficult to create a large amount of complete sandbags in a short period of time that could be used immediately for restoration work.

(Problems that the invention attempts to solve) This invention was created in view of the problems mentioned above and to solve them, and its purpose is to:
To provide a sandbag making machine capable of producing a large quantity of complete sandbags in a short time that can be used immediately for restoration work.

(Operation) Earth and sand are put into the hopper and stirred by the stirring device.

When the opening of the sandbag bag is manually placed over the outside of the variable diameter body located at the bag attachment position, the bag is held by the holding device and rotated toward the earth and sand filling position.

When the bag reaches the earth and sand filling position, the earth and sand delivery device is activated and a predetermined amount of earth and sand is sent out from the chute.
Earth and sand are poured into the bag via a funnel located below. At this time, the bag filled with earth and sand is supported by the table and rotated toward the binding position.

When the bag reaches the binding position, the diameter variable body is reduced in diameter while the opening of the bag is held by the holding device, and the table is raised to facilitate binding.

Then, the tying device is operated and the opening of the bag is squeezed and tied by the tying tool. In other words, the bags filled with earth and sand are tied together in a so-called kinchaku bag shape to form sandbags, and the bags are rotated toward the carrying-out position.

When the sandbag reaches the carry-out position, its opening is released from the holding device and the sandbag is transported from the table to the outside of the machine.

The above-mentioned steps are then repeated to create sandbags.
